This movie feels closer to a more nationalistic Zhang production: the opening and closing ceremonies of the 2008 Beijing Olympics. Zhang has balanced spectacle and social conscience in such powerful dramas as Raise the Red Lantern and staged dazzling action in fanciful romps such as House of Flying Daggers. Originally assigned to Edward Zwick, the film was ultimately directed by Zhang Yimou, but it's not a testament to his skill or sensibility.

Occasionally, the rhythm slows so that Lin can teach William the Chinese virtues of cooperation and self-sacrifice. Most of the movie is devoted to quick-cut combat and creepy-monster mayhem. By comparison, the Cultural Revolution was a paper cut. Led by their queen, the Taotie intend to breach the wall, attack the capital, and eat the boy emperor and everyone else. The monsters attack every 60 years, and are "evolving" intelligence at a rate that could make Darwinists reconsider the great man's theory. It's bonkers in theory, but prosaic in execution. This scenario may make The Great Wall sound entertainingly demented, but as so-nuts-it's-good spectacle, the movie disappoints. While being chased, the last two interlopers find their path blocked by that big wall and the troops that protect China from the menaces on the north side of the barrier. The outlanders' goal is to acquire some gunpowder, a Chinese invention with solid commercial prospects in war-happy Europe.Īll the other rascals except Tovar (Chilean actor Pedro Pascal) are quickly dispatched.

Most prominent among these thieves and mercenaries is William (Matt Damon), who's supposed to be British, although the actor doesn't further burden his stiff line readings with a feigned brogue. Opening a few miles from its namesake, The Great Wall introduces a group of European knaves who have somehow trekked to northwestern China during the Song Dynasty (960-1279).
